Trustworthy Systems

Towards an OS platform for truly dependable real-time systems


Gernot Heiser

    School of Computer Science and Engineering
    Sydney 2052, Australia


Keynote at Workshop on Operating System Platforms for Embedded Real-Time Applications (OSPERT)


Many embedded systems are used in mission or even life-critical scenarios, and their dependability is paramount. The growing functionality, and resulting complexity, means that the traditional bare-metal approach is no longer feasible for such systems. This necessitates the use of spatial and temporal isolation, enforced by an operating system or hypervisor.

The dependability of the system then hinges on the dependability of that OS platform: it must ensure at least the integrity and timely execution of critical subsystems in the presence of malfunctions in non-critical parts. The talk presents our roadmap to such a platform, and discusses progress to date.

BibTeX Entry

    author           = {Gernot Heiser},
    howpublished     = {Keynote at Workshop on Operating System Platforms for Embedded Real-Time Applications (OSPERT),
                        Porto, Portugal},
    month            = jul,
    title            = {Towards an {OS} Platform for Truly Dependable Real-Time Systems},
    url              = {},
    year             = {2011}
